Philosophying
I wonder, have we come to the end?
The world in chaos, in downward trend.
Is this all of our beautiful tale?
There's magic to ponder and regale.
Icarus led us so close we burned?
That's a lesson needing to be learned.
Is innocence tossed on ships of hate?
Temptation lingers beyond truth's gate.
Is majesty wondered or turned frail?
That's found in all, large and tiny-scale.
is a place found for wild in our world?
There's hidden magic in manes unfurled.
Imagining, where is beauty found?
The sunsets, stars, gentle evening's sound
Is life an illusion and then gone?
Trust in your heart, find forever's song.
Is earth to survive the tempest's wave?
That's on our shoulders to try to save.
